Current - Output (Max): | 2.5A |
Size / Dimension: | 2.40" L x 2.28" W x 0.50" H (61.0mm x 57.9mm x 12.7mm) |
Package / Case: | 9-DIP Module |
Mounting Type: | Through Hole |
Efficiency: | 90% |
Operating Temperature: | -55°C ~ 85°C |
Features: | Remote On/Off, OCP, OTP, OVP |
Applications: | ITE (Commercial) |
Voltage - Isolation: | 3kV |
Power (Watts): | 25W |
Series: | MI-J00™ |
Voltage - Output 3: | -- |
Voltage - Output 2: | -- |
Voltage - Output 1: | 10V |
Voltage - Input (Max): | 50V |
Voltage - Input (Min): | 18V |
Number of Outputs: | 1 |
Type: | Isolated Module |
Part Status: | Active |
Packaging: | Bulk |
